Deborah K. Reed; Emily Martin; Eliot Hazeltine; Bob McMurray – Journal of Special Education Technology, 2020
To inform the development of gamified assessments, this study explored how students with or at risk for reading difficulties in Grades 6-8 (N = 202) perceived and interacted with a decoding assessment designed with gamification characteristics. Three data sources enhanced the methodological triangulation: observations and scores from testing,…

Poole, Frederick J.; Clarke-Midura, Jody – Language Learning & Technology, 2023
Research involving digital games and language learning is rapidly growing. One advantage of using digital games to support language learning is the ability to collect data on students learning in real time. In this study, we use educational data mining methods to explore the relationship between in-game data and elementary students' Chinese…
